摘要

This letter presents a compact wideband slot antenna for Wi-Fi 6E application. It evolved from the full wave bow-tie slot antenna, and four short slits are loaded on the metal plate with conjugate reactance to improve impedance matching at the extended 6 GHz band. The dimension of the proposed antenna is 39 × 39 mm, which is 0.32 × 0.32 λ at 2.45 GHz. The antenna has omnidirectional radiation at 2.45 GHz band, and it remains quasiomnidirectional radiation at 5 and 6 GHz bands with vertically polarized radiation. The prototype antenna is fabricated and measured for verification. The result shows that the wide bandwidth for return loss (RL) better than 10 dB is 104 from 2.35 to 7.44 GHz, and the radiation efficiencies are nearly 80 at the triple bands.
机译:这封信介绍了一款用于 Wi-Fi 6E 应用的紧凑型宽带缝隙天线。它由全波蝴蝶结缝隙天线演变而来,在金属板上加载了四个短狭缝,并具有共轭电抗,以改善扩展 6 GHz 频段的阻抗匹配。拟议天线的尺寸为 39 × 39 mm,在 2.45 GHz 时为 0.32 × 0.32 λ。该天线在 2.45 GHz 频段具有全向辐射,并且在 5 GHz 和 6 GHz 频段保持准全向辐射,具有垂直极化辐射。制作并测量原型天线以进行验证。结果表明,在2.35-7.44 GHz范围内,优于10 dB的回波损耗(RL)宽带宽为104%,三频段的辐射效率接近80%。
